US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"ask for perspectives"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when you want to request different viewpoints or opinions on a particular topic or issue. Example: "In our next meeting, I would like to ask for perspectives from each team member on how we can improve our workflow."

FAQs

How can I effectively "ask for perspectives" in a professional setting?

Be direct in your request, providing context and explaining why you value their input. Frame it as a collaborative effort to foster open communication and encourage honest feedback.

What's a more formal way to "ask for perspectives"?

Consider using phrases like "solicit viewpoints" or "request input" for a more professional tone.

Is it better to "ask for perspectives" from a diverse group or a group with similar backgrounds?

It depends on your goal. A diverse group can provide a broader range of ideas, while a group with similar backgrounds may offer deeper insights within a specific area.

What should I do after I "ask for perspectives" from others?

Acknowledge and appreciate the input you receive. Analyze the different viewpoints, identify common themes, and use the insights to inform your decision-making process.
